I. Understanding IP subnetting:

IP subnetting is a procedure that separates networks into smaller networks or subnetworks to improve performance of the network as well as manage IP address allocation. It involves creating virtual subdivisions within a larger network, and assigning unique IP addresses to each subnet. This allows for efficient data routing and enhances security.

III. IP Subnet cheat sheet: the most important components:

1. Subnet mask: The subnet mask determines the host and network portions of an address. The cheat sheet can be used as a quick reference to help determine the subnet in relation to the number of network bits are available.

2. Network Address Network Address: A network address is the primary address for the subnet. It is used to identify the subnet within the larger network.

3. Broadcast address: The broadcast address is the primary address of the subnet. This address is used for sending data to all devices on the subnet.

4. Host Range: The host range includes all valid IP addresses assignable to devices in an subnet, with the exception of network and broadcast addresses.

5. CIDR Notation: Classless Inter-Domain Route (CIDR) notation is the subnet mask by using the Slash Notation (/) followed by the number of bits in the network. To aid in quick reference the cheat sheet contains a conversion chart.
